## Adding New Chip Support For Debugging
|
||||
|
||||
1. Dump .rodata strings via `riscv32-esp-elf-readelf -p .rodata esp32c5_rev0_rom.elf`
|
||||
2. Locate the build date in the output (e.g. `[ 23c4] Mar 29 2024`).
|
||||
3. Get start address of .rodata section via `riscv32-esp-elf-readelf -S esp32c5_rev0_rom.elf | grep rodata`
|
||||
4. Compute the absolute address by adding the offset from step 2 to the base address from step 3.
|
||||
5. Verify with GDB:
|
||||
```
|
||||
riscv32-esp-elf-gdb esp32c5_rev0_rom.elf -ex "p (char*) 0x4004b3c4" --batch
|
||||
$1 = 0x4004b3c4 "Mar 29 2024"
|
||||
```
|
||||
6. Update roms.json:
|
||||
```
|
||||
"esp32c5": [
|
||||
{
|
||||
"rev": 0,
|
||||
"build_date_str_addr": "0x4004b3c4",
|
||||
"build_date_str": "Mar 29 2024"
|
||||
}
|
||||
],
|
||||
```
